Jim B. wrote: Don't give your money to that guy. It's over priced, and it looks like it's a converted "Grid". Did he do this conversion himself, or did Emmett do it?There is also a knob missing from the Stickup. there is a reason it hasn't sold after 4 listings. Converted Grid? All Sticks that are supplied from the factory with the GK option installed are called Grids (to the best of my knowledge) - my purple heart grand is and my paduak grand is - and it only has the slot pre-cut for the pickup, doesn't even have the GK installed..... Regarding the price - considering it has $700 worth of GK on it - I figure is pretty fair. Now, I am a bit concerned about the missing knob, though you can get one from Stick Ent., makes me wonder if there were 'care' issues with it... Dave
